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Ashton-under-Lyne to St Helens Central start from £14.00 one way, or £14.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Ashton-under-Lyne to St Helens Central are available for £14.80 one way, or £16.70 return

Everything you need to know about Ashton-under-Lyne Station

Welcome to Ashton-under-Lyne Train Station

Nestled in the heart of Greater Manchester, Ashton-under-Lyne train station serves as a crucial hub, connecting travelers to a variety of vibrant destinations. Whether you're commuting to work, exploring the region, or setting off on an exciting adventure, Ashton-under-Lyne station provides the facilities and services to ease your journey.

Facilities and Amenities

The station offers numerous facilities for a smooth and comfortable travel experience. With a ticket office open from 06:55 to 20:05 on weekdays, and accessible ticket machines, purchasing your ticket is straightforward. The station accommodates modern conveniences such as smartcards, though it's worth noting that smartcard validators are not available. To assist your journey, an induction loop system is in place for those with hearing impairments.

While the station does not feature waiting rooms, it does provide seating areas for your comfort. Accessible toilets are available, and for those needing additional assistance, ramps and step-free access are in place. If you need help during your visit, customer help points are accessible, ensuring that support is only a step away. However, there are no refreshment facilities or ATMs on-site, so consider preparing ahead for this.

Everything you need to know about St Helens Central Station

Welcome to St Helens Central Train Station

St Helens Central Train Station, located in the Merseyside region of North West England, is a bustling hub for commuters and travelers alike. Whether you're heading into the heart of Liverpool or exploring the scenic surroundings of Lancashire and beyond, this station is your ticket to adventure. With well-connected routes and a wide range of facilities, St Helens Central is committed to offering a smooth, convenient travel experience.

Facilities and Services at St Helens Central

The station is equipped with a variety of amenities to make your journey smoother. For ticket purchasing and collection, the station offers a ticket office that operates from early morning to late evening. Additionally, there are ticket machines that are fully accessible, and you can easily collect tickets purchased online. If you're a smartcard user, you'll be pleased to find that the station can issue and validate smartcards.

Accessibility is another strength of the station. It boasts step-free access throughout, ensuring easy navigation for all passengers, including those with reduced mobility. The station is categorized as a 'Category A' and 'Scooter Friendly' station, offering ramps, lifts, and accessible toilets to cater to everyone. For any assistance needs, staff are available from early to late, with helpline services for additional support.

Although the station does not house refreshment facilities or shops, you'll find basics such as payphones and CCTV for safety. While the bicycle hire isn't available on-site, cycling enthusiasts can make use of the dedicated storage area with hoops and CCTV for added security.

Onward Travel From St Helens Central

Continuing your journey from St Helens Central is made simple with various travel links. The station features a taxi rank with accessible 'black cabs' ready to take you to your next destination. For local connections, buses are just a short five-minute walk away at the nearest bus station. You can reach them via Busline at 0871 200 2233 for more information on routes and schedules.

For unexpected rail disruptions, a Rail Replacement Service picks up and drops off on the station forecourt. Whether you're heading to a meeting or embarking on a holiday, these transport links ensure you can travel with ease and flexibility.
